localisation actuelle:Maison > Articles techniques > programmation quotidienne > Connaissance PHP
- Direction:
- tous web3.0 développement back-end interface Web base de données Opération et maintenance outils de développement cadre php programmation quotidienne Applet WeChat Problème commun autre technologie Tutoriel CMS Java Tutoriel système tutoriels informatiques Tutoriel matériel Tutoriel mobile Tutoriel logiciel Tutoriel de jeu mobile
-
- Quelles sont les meilleures pratiques pour écrire des fonctions PHP réutilisables?
- Pour rédiger des fonctions PHP réutilisables, vous devez suivre les points clés suivants: 1. La fonction doit avoir une seule responsabilité, telle que la division des données d'acquisition et de mise en forme en deux fonctions pour améliorer la réutilisabilité; 2. La dénomination doit être claire et cohérente, comme utiliser Formatdate () au lieu de DoSomething (), et suivant la spécification Camelcase; 3. Rendez la fonction configurable via des paramètres, tels que l'ajout de paramètres et les valeurs par défaut pour SendNotification; 4. évitez les effets secondaires et les dépendances globales et transmettez des données externes telles que $ _post comme paramètres; 5. Ajouter des documents et des invites de type autant que possible, comme utiliser des commentaires pour illustrer la fonction et utiliser les déclarations de type. Ces pratiques améliorent la maintenabilité du code et la robustesse.
- tutoriel php . développement back-end 740 2025-07-21 10:35:11
-
- Quelle est une valeur d'argument par défaut dans une fonction PHP?
- DefaultArgumentValuesInphpallowAfonctionParameTerTous apredEfinedValueIfNoneisprovidedUring affecter-to-clonDEt, améliorant la finalité et la réduction de la finalité de la définition.
- tutoriel php . développement back-end 445 2025-07-21 10:33:31
-
- Qu'est-ce qu'une fonction récursive en PHP?
- Les fonctions récursives sont des fonctions qui s'appellent lors de l'exécution, adaptées aux scénarios qui peuvent être décomposés en problèmes similaires plus petits. Ses éléments principaux incluent: 1) la fonction s'appelle en interne et 2) l'exemple de base qui doit être inclus pour terminer la récursivité. Les applications courantes incluent la traversée des répertoires, le calcul des factorielles et le traitement des structures de données imbriquées. Lorsque vous l'utilisez, assurez-vous que chaque récursivité est plus proche du bo?tier de base et veillez à éviter les problèmes de débordement de mémoire et de pile.
- tutoriel php . développement back-end 638 2025-07-21 10:33:12
-
- Que sont les arguments de longueur variable (fonctions variadiques) dans PHP?
- Dans PHP, utilisez l'opérateur ... pour définir des fonctions qui acceptent le nombre variable de paramètres. 1. Depuis PHP5.6, vous pouvez le transformer en un tableau en ajoutant ... Avant les paramètres de fonction, tels que FunctionSum (... Nombres $). 2. Les anciennes versions doivent traiter manuellement les paramètres avec des fonctions telles que func_get_args (). 3. Les paramètres variables conviennent aux opérations mathématiques, à la construction de la liste dynamique et à d'autres scénarios, mais la surutilisation doit être évitée. Lors de la fixation des paramètres, ils doivent être clairement déclarés améliorer la lisibilité et la maintenance.
- tutoriel php . développement back-end 523 2025-07-21 10:32:11
-
- Comment pouvez-vous documenter efficacement vos fonctions PHP?
- Pour enregistrer efficacement les fonctions PHP, vous devez d'abord utiliser PHPDOC pour la documentation en ligne, deuxièmement, garder la description claire et orientée vers l'opération, et enfin conserver un guide de référence distinct pour les projets complexes. Les étapes spécifiques sont les suivantes: 1. Utilisez PHPDOC pour annoter les fonctions, y compris @param, @return et @throws; 2. Décrivez les fonctions spécifiques des fonctions, évitez les déclarations floues et expliquez la situation de bord; 3. Pour les grands projets, utilisez des outils pour générer des sites de documents navigables; 4. Enregistrez avec précision le type de retour, utilisez @Deprecated pour marquer les fonctions obsolètes et conservez le document. Ces pratiques peuvent améliorer la maintenabilité du code et réduire les malentendus.
- tutoriel php . développement back-end 358 2025-07-21 10:30:15
-
- Qu'est-ce que les tests unitaires pour les fonctions PHP?
- Les tests unitaires en PHP se réfèrent à l'écriture de petits tests indépendants pour des fonctions distinctes pour vérifier que leur comportement est comme prévu. Par exemple, lors du test d'une fonction d'addition à l'aide du framework PHPUnit, vous pouvez rédiger le cas de test suivant: publicFonctionTestAdDreturnsSumoftWonumbers () {$ this-> assertequals (5, add (2,3));}, qui vérifie la détection précoce des erreurs; 2. Prise en charge de la reconstruction sécurisée; 3. Comportement de la fonction documentée. Les étapes pour commencer à utiliser le test unitaire PHP sont: 1. Installer via le compositeur
- tutoriel php . développement back-end 574 2025-07-21 10:29:11
-
- Commentant le code en php
- Il existe trois méthodes courantes pour le code de commentaire PHP: 1. Utiliser // ou # pour bloquer une ligne de code, et il est recommandé d'utiliser //; 2. Utiliser /.../ pour envelopper des blocs de code avec plusieurs lignes, qui ne peuvent pas être imbriquées mais peuvent être croisées; 3. Compétences combinées Commentaires tels que l'utilisation / if () {} / pour contr?ler les blocs logiques, ou pour améliorer l'efficacité avec les touches de raccourci de l'éditeur, vous devez prêter attention aux symboles de fermeture et éviter les nidification lorsque vous les utilisez.
- tutoriel php . développement back-end 612 2025-07-18 04:57:20
-
- Opérateurs de comparaison PHP
- Les opérateurs de comparaison PHP doivent faire attention aux problèmes de conversion de type. 1. Utiliser == pour comparer les valeurs uniquement, et la conversion de type sera effectuée, comme 1 == "1" est vraie; 2. Utilisation === Pour nécessiter la même valeur que le type, tel que 1 === "1" est faux; 3. La comparaison de taille peut être utilisée sur les valeurs et les cha?nes, telles que "Apple"
- tutoriel php . développement back-end 493 2025-07-18 04:57:00
-
- Syntaxe PHP Array: Création, accès et manipulation
- Il existe deux fa?ons principales de créer des tableaux en PHP: utilisez la fonction Array () ou l'abréviation []. Ce dernier est recommandé car il est concis et facile à lire. Lorsque vous accédez aux éléments de tableau, vous devez faire la distinction entre les réseaux d'index et les tableaux associatifs, et veillez à éviter les erreurs causées par l'accès aux indices non définis; Les tableaux de fonctionnement incluent l'ajout, la modification, la suppression et la recherche d'éléments, l'ajout d'informations vides disponibles ou la spécification des clés, la modification de l'attribution directe, la suppression de l'utilisation unset () et la détermination de la manière respectivement de la clé ou de la valeur en utilisant ISSET () et In_Array () respectivement.
- tutoriel php . développement back-end 177 2025-07-18 04:56:41
-
- Constantes PHP: const vs
- La définition des constantes dans PHP, const est plus adapté aux définitions constantes à l'intérieur des classes, et Define () est plus flexible et adaptée aux définitions globales ou dynamiques. 1.Const est une structure linguistique et doit être une expression constante de compilation lorsqu'elle est définie, ce qui convient aux espaces de noms de classe ou globaux; Define () est une fonction, et la valeur peut être le résultat d'un calcul d'exécution. 2.Const est affecté par l'espace de noms, et les constantes définies par Define () sont visibles par défaut globalement. 3. La structure const est claire et l'IDE est bonne, ce qui convient à la conception orientée objet; Define () a une forte flexibilité mais peut avoir des co?ts d'entretien plus élevés. 4. Define () prend en charge le jugement de la condition d'exécution et la définition dynamique, mais const ne le prend en charge. Par conséquent, les constantes liées à la classe utilisent préférentiellement le CO
- tutoriel php . développement back-end 574 2025-07-18 04:56:20
-
- PHP commentant la syntaxe
- Il existe trois fa?ons courantes d'utiliser les commentaires PHP: les commentaires en une seule ligne conviennent à l'explication brièvement de la logique de code, telle que // ou # pour l'explication de la ligne actuelle; Commentaires multi-lignes /*...*/ convient à une description détaillée des fonctions ou des classes; COMMENTAIRES DOCUMENTS DOCBLOCK Commencez par / ** pour fournir des informations rapides pour l'IDE. Lorsque vous l'utilisez, vous devez éviter les bêtises, continuez à mettre à jour de manière synchrone et n'utilisez pas de commentaires pour bloquer les codes pendant longtemps.
- tutoriel php . développement back-end 647 2025-07-18 04:56:01
-
- Commentaires bons vs mauvais PHP
- Les commentaires sont cruciaux dans le code car ils améliorent la lisibilité et la maintenance du code, en particulier dans des projets comme PHP qui sont multi-collaboratifs et maintenance à long terme. Les raisons de la rédaction de commentaires comprennent l'explication ?pourquoi faire cela? pour permettre du temps de débogage et être amical avec les débutants et réduire les co?ts de communication. La représentation de bons commentaires comprend l'explication du r?le des fonctions ou des classes pour expliquer le marquage de l'intention logique complexe ou les problèmes potentiels, et la rédaction d'annotations de documentation de l'interface API. Les manifestations typiques des mauvais commentaires incluent des commentaires de contenu de code répété qui ne sont pas cohérents avec le code et l'utilisation des commentaires pour couvrir le mauvais code et conserver les anciennes informations. Les suggestions d'écriture des commentaires incluent la hiérarchisation des commentaires "Pourquoi" Garder les commentaires synchronisés avec le code utilise un format unifié pour éviter les instructions émotionnelles et envisager d'optimiser le code plut?t que de compter sur les commentaires lorsque le code est difficile à comprendre.
- tutoriel php . développement back-end 982 2025-07-18 04:55:40
-
- Configuration de l'environnement de développement PHP
- La première étape consiste à sélectionner le package d'environnement intégré XAMPP ou MAMP pour créer un serveur local; La deuxième étape consiste à sélectionner la version PHP appropriée en fonction des besoins du projet et de configurer la commutation de la version multiple; La troisième étape consiste à sélectionner VScode ou PhpStorm comme éditeur et déboguer avec xdebug; De plus, vous devez installer Composer, PHP_CODESNIFFER, PHPUNIT et d'autres outils pour aider au développement.
- tutoriel php . développement back-end 927 2025-07-18 04:55:21
-
- Code propre et commentaires PHP
- La rédaction du bon code et des annotations peut améliorer la maintenabilité du projet et le professionnalisme. 1.Cleancode met l'accent sur la dénomination claire, les responsabilités et les structures uniques, de sorte qu'il est facile à comprendre pour les autres; 2. Les commentaires doivent expliquer "pourquoi" plut?t que des fonctions de code en double; 3. Les commentaires PHP doivent couvrir les descriptions de classe, les paramètres de la méthode et les arrière-plans logiques clés; 4. Les suggestions pratiques incluent l'utilisation de noms de variables significatifs, le style d'annotation unifié et l'utilisation des spécifications de l'outil.
- tutoriel php . développement back-end 895 2025-07-18 04:55:00
Recommandations d'outils

